The Best Time to Visit the Sundarbans
Planning your Sundarban tour entails understanding the various experiences offered by exceptional seasons. Here’s a breakdown of what each season involves:
Monsoon Season (June to September)
The monsoon rains paint the Sundarbans in lush greenery, making it an awe-inspiring sight. However, heavy rains and slippery paths can pose challenges. Boat safaris may be limited because of unpredictable weather situations and heightened water tiers.
• Pros: Ideal for witnessing the transformation of the forest into its most colorful shape. Fewer travelers mean quieter exploration.
• Cons: Wildlife recognition is less common due to dense greenery and hard climate.
• Verdict: Suitable for seasoned adventurers or the ones seeking out solitude in nature.
Post-Monsoon (October to Early December)
This is taken into consideration as one of the first-rate instances to visit the Sundarbans.
The weather becomes pleasant and the forest retains its lush beauty from the rains. Rivers and water bodies are brimming, offering excellent conditions for boat safaris.
• Pros: High chances of spotting wildlife, including deer, crocodiles, and a variety of birds. Comfortable temperatures make excursions enjoyable.
• Cons: Moderately high traveler influx.
• Verdict: Perfect for the ones looking for stability of first-rate weather and a vibrant wooded area panorama.
Winter Season (December to February)
Winter is the peak touring season for the Sundarbans and for suitable causes. The dry and funky climate creates the most cushy conditions for exploration. Wildlife is frequently seen basking inside the warm temperature of the iciness solar, and migratory birds from around the world make the forests their transient domestic.
• Pros: Ideal for wildlife spotting, especially tigers. Birdwatching fans will locate wintry weather as a paradise. Excellent conditions for boat safaris and trekking.
• Cons: The popularity of this season way larger crowds and limited lodging availability if no longer booked in advance.
• Verdict: The ultimate season for a Sundarbans tour in case you need to witness the pleasantness of its biodiversity.
Summer Season (March to May)
While summer isn’t the maximum preferred time due to excessive humidity and warmth, it does include possibilities for wildlife sightings. Tigers and other animals have a tendency to visit water bodies more frequently to cool off.
• Pros: Increased possibilities of seeing elusive wildlife near water sources. Minimal visitor traffic.
• Cons: Hot, humid weather may additionally make some activities tough.
• Verdict: Ideal for more determined natural world photographers and adventurers.
Wildlife and Habitats of the Sundarbans
The Sundarbans is a biodiversity hotspot and boasts a wide array of species dwelling harmoniously in its unique surroundings.
The Royal Bengal Tiger
The spotlight of most Sundarban excursions is the chance to spot the majestic Royal Bengal Tiger. Known for his or her elusive nature, those tigers have adapted to live to tell the tale inside the saline, swampy terrain.
Saltwater Crocodiles
Often visible basking alongside riverbanks, saltwater crocodiles are another iconic species of the Sundarbans.
Avian Wonders
With over 300 chook species, including kingfishers, herons, and eagles, the Sundarbans is a birding paradise, particularly in winter when migratory birds flock right here.
Mangrove Ecosystem
Besides the captivating fauna, the mangroves themselves are a surprise. Adapted to thrive in saline water, they play a essential position in defensive this inclined region from cyclones.
